Kaizer Chiefs winger Lehlogonolo George Matlou is one of the players at the club whose future might be hanging in the balance as previously reported by the Siya Crew.
The former Swallows FC player has arguably not been effective since he joined the Glamour Boys which has resulted in reports about him possibly being loaned out or potentially released.

However, Siya sources have indicated that Chiefs could possibly keep him until the end of his contract in June 2024.
Sources very close to the club added that since no team has shown interest in the Soweto born 24-year-old yet, that is why they could then keep him at the club.
"For now they have no choice or very little choice as he is still contracted to them," said the Siya source.
"Unless they want to pay him off for the remaining year then he can be a free agent. But they don't want to do that and that's why they want to see him finish his contract.
"It's a tricky situation for the club as they want players who can play in that position but at the same time they are avoiding having just too many players and having a huge salary bill at the end of the month.
"So, they will keep him hoping that suitors will come through and mainly to buy him straight out as he only has a year remaining on his contract," the source said.
Matlou had last played for the team on May 13 when they lost 1-0 to SuperSport United and that was his 12th league appearance of the campaign. He created just one assist all season.
The Siya crew contacted Chiefs but no comment was received while preparing this story.
